SQL lint stage in the Quarrel pipeline blocks merges on unparameterized literals and grant statements. Recent failures trace to migration files bypassing the pre-commit hook. Enforcement now runs server-side; no exemptions without sign-off from Osric. All findings are archived per run for audit. The run confirming the enforcement change is tagged with the token below.

session token of bawep-yadup = htk21_528abd376e3c5a4ec24a1

Handover — Chartwright report builder sorting

Sorting is now stable: ties preserve ingestion order via a hidden sequence column. The old comparator occasionally reshuffled equal keys between page loads, which caused last week's ticket flood. Fix shipped Tuesday; no regressions observed. If pages disagree across refreshes, check the sequence index first. Current service configuration follows.

config for kajog-tadug:
[casax]
port = 11211
region = west-3
host = casax.nelvroworks.internal
timeout_ms = 5000
retries = 7

## Idempotency Keys for Payment Retries (Lumopay)

Every retry of a charge request must reuse the original idempotency key; generating a new key on retry can produce duplicate charges. Keys are scoped per merchant and expire after 48 hours. Reviewers should verify keys are derived server-side, never from client input. The full key-generation specification and threat model are maintained on the internal page.

dashboard of kaguf-tawip = https://vault.merlaqsys.test/issue

Handover — Relevance Tuning (Marit to Osgood)

The Seapine relevance notes live in the tuning workbook; all boost experiments since April are logged there. Please review the synonym expansion rules before sign-off, since they touch indexed customer terms. Nothing here changes auth scopes. The ranking service was last deployed with the values listed below.

deployment values, kajep-kageg:
[praix]
host = praix.paliqcorp.corp
user = praix_svc
database = praix_prod